Medical Attention

Millions of people are impacted by car accidents each day. This includes injuries that range from minor bumps and bruises up to major issues which can stop you from working for weeks or months.

Adrenaline and other endocrines flood the bloodstream in response to traumatizing circumstances like car accidents. The result is a boost in energy and makes them believe they aren't injured, which can cover the pain.

If the body does not receive prompt medical attention there are hidden issues that can arise which are only discovered later. These may include internal bleeding broken bones organ damage, brain injuries.

The symptoms may be delayed by days, hours, or even weeks if treated. The longer you put off getting get checked out the more likely that you'll be missing out on crucial information needed to establish your case and claim compensation for your injuries.

Many people who have been involved in car accidents decide to delay going to the doctor because they believe that their injuries will heal on their own, or they're worried about the cost of visiting a doctor. Although this is an occurrence, it's also one that could be detrimental in the long time.

In fact delays in medical treatment are frequently used against insurance companies to deny your claim. The longer you put off getting receive medical attention and the more difficult it will be to prove that you were involved in a crash and therefore entitled to compensation.

Following a car accident, your doctor will examine the injuries you sustained and determine if they are serious. They might prescribe medication to treat your injuries and prevent further complications.

You will also be able with them on an appropriate treatment plan. Exercise and rest, referrals for other specialists or physical therapists might be part of the plan. Additionally, the doctor will refer you to x-rays, MRIs or CT scans which will allow them to determine the extent of your injuries and if they are life-threatening.

Contacting the Police

It is crucial to immediately contact the police after an accident. This will help you to collect information and avoid issues with the driver or their insurance.

If you call the police, tell them exactly what occurred. Give them all the information they require to prepare reports or answer any questions that arise.

Remember that police officers can often determine fault for a crash based on their observations. This is essential should you decide to file an insurance claim or bring the other driver to court.

You should also inform the police if you feel your vehicle is in an unsafe location or when the safety of the other driver is in danger. You'll also need to tell the police about any injuries or damage you've suffered.

Additionally, police officers can assist in verifying the identity of any witnesses on the scene who have witnessed what happened to you. Make sure to obtain the names, addresses, and telephone numbers of any witnesses you can locate.

You should also take photographs of the damage to your vehicle as well as any other vehicles involved in the collision. This can be extremely helpful in determining who's at fault and if there are any injuries or damage to property.

The police typically provide a written report that can be very useful in determining the cause of the crash and determining who is at fault. This report can be very useful in proving your guilt as well as helping you get compensation for any damage you sustained in the accident.

Contacting Insurance Companies

It's essential to contact your insurance provider if you've been involved in a car accident. Inability to contact your insurance provider could result in a denial of your claim or cancellation of your insurance policy, or an increase in your premiums.

Your insurance company is likely to want to know the cause of the accident, what injuries you sustained as well as your medical expenses. They will also require you to tell them who was at fault.

In addition to contacting your insurance company, it's recommended to contact the insurer of the other driver as well and request copies of their insurance papers. This will help you process your claim faster.

When you're contacted by an insurance adjuster it is important to remain at peace and provide accurate information regarding the incident. The adjuster will make use of all the information available to deny your claim or settle it for less than what it's worth.

A lawyer can help protect your rights and interests in this instance. They can speak to the insurer of the other driver on your behalf and help obtain the compensation you're entitled to.
